Question

A ball is thrown vertically upward with a speed of 25.0 m/s. How long does the ball take to hit the ground after it reaches its highest point?

Solution

The correct option is A 2.5s
When the ball reaches the highest point, its velocity will be zero. So final velocity is v=0m/s
Here, the time to reach highest point is equal to time to hit ground from highest point.
Consider upward motion, the acceleration of the ball is a=g=9.8m/s2 (minus for motion opposite to gravity)
If t be the required time.
Using v=u+at,
0=25+(9.8)t
t=2.5s
Thus the ball hits the ground after 2.5 seconds after reaching its highest point.
